FPGA Implementation of Efficient Viterbi Decoder for Multi-Carrier Systems
Journal Title: International Journal of Modern Engineering Research (IJMER) - Year 2014, Vol 4, Issue 9
Abstract
In this paper, we concern with designing and implementing a Convolutional encoder and Adaptive Viterbi Decoder (AVD) which are the essential blocks in digital communication system using FPGA technology. Convolutional coding is a coding scheme used in communication systems for error correction employed in applications like deep space communications and wireless communications. It provides an alternative approach to block codes for transmission over a noisy channel. The block codes can be applied only for the blocks of data where as the Convolutional coding has an advantage that it can be applied to both continuous data stream and blocks of data. The Viterbi decoder with PNPH (Permutation Network based Path History) management unit which is a special path management unit for faster decoding speed with less routing area. The proposed architecture can be realized by an Adaptive Viterbi Decoder having constraint length, K of 3 and a code rate (k/n) of 1/2 using Verilog HDL. Simulation is done using Xilinx ISE 12.4i design software and it is targeted into Xilinx Virtex-5, XC5VLX110T FPGA
Authors and Affiliations
K. Rajendar , K. Bapayya
Effect of SC5D Additive on the Performance and Emission Characteristics of CI Engine
In this experimental work polymer based additive are mixed in different proportions with diesel fuel. Their emissions and performance results are compared with base fuel diesel. By mixing of this additive, it is ob...
Solidification Simulation of Aluminum Alloy Casting – A Theoretical and Experimental Approach
Aluminium alloy castings are extensively used in general engineering, automotive and aerospace industries due to their excellent castability, machinability and high strength-to-weight ratio. The major problem w...
Design of Cooling Package of Diesel Genset
Traditional cooling systems have relied on a mechanical coolant pump and an engine mounted radiator fan driven off the engine’s crankshaft. The compactness of the system often turned out to be a problem when the generato...
Investigation of Effects of impact loads on Framed Structures
This research work consists of a general overview of numerical analysis and dynamic response of framed structures under impact loading. The purpose of the work is to introduce the Finite Element Method which is dif...
A Novel Switch Mechanism for Load Balancing in Public Cloud
In cloud computing environment, one of the core design principles is dynamic scalability, which guarantees cloud storage service to handle the growing amounts of application data in a flexible manner or to be readily enl...